How much pasta is in one jar of sauce?

For tomato-based sauces, a good rule ofthumb to follow is to use one jar of 24-ounce pastasauce for every 16-ounce package of pasta. Whencalculating how much sauce for pasta per person,generally about 2 to 4 ounces (1/4 to 1/2 cup) ofsauce for each 2 ounce (about 1 cup cooked) servingof pasta would be needed.

Do you add sauce to pasta or pasta to sauce?

Don't drain all of the pasta water: Pastawater is a great addition to the sauce. Add about a¼-1/2 cup or ladle full of water to your sauce beforeadding the pasta. The salty, starchy water not onlyadds flavor but helps glue the pasta and saucetogether; it will also help thicken the sauce.

Can you cook pasta in spaghetti sauce?

The chef claims you can cook the pastadirectly in a pan full of tomato sauce. Simply thin sometomato sauce with water, bring it to a boil, dump thedry spaghetti into it, and cook it for about 15minutes, stirring occasionally so the pasta doesn't stick tothe bottom of the pan, until an al-dente texture isreached.

How much is a portion of pasta per person?

For small portions, for a starter, allow 50gdried or 90g fresh pasta per person. For normalportions, for a lunch with a salad, say, cook 70-80g driedor 100-110g fresh pasta per person. Everything depends, ofcourse, on the quality and the shape of the pasta, and onappetite.

How long do you cook pasta sauce from a jar?

Simply pour the sauce into a small saucepan whileyou're going about boiling your pasta. Let it cometo a boil, then reduce the heat so that thesauce gently bubbles. Keep the simmer going for about 10minutes or so, until you've noticed that the saucehas reduced and thickened a little, but is stillsaucy.

Is Barilla pasta sauce gluten free?

Barilla. Out of 12 Barilla tomato-basedsauces, six flavors are considered gluten-free(to less than 20 parts per million): marinara, meat, mushroom,roasted garlic, spicy marinara, and sweet peppers. Barilla'straditional basil pesto, its creamy Alfredo, and its garlic Alfredoare not gluten-free.

How do Italians eat spaghetti?

''In Italy it is customary to first place thepasta in a bowl or on a plate,'' Mr. Giovanetti said. ''Youthen spoon the sauce on top and finally cheese, if you use it atall. You use your fork and spoon to toss the pasta withsauce and cheese, and you then eat it with your forkalone.''

Why is it bad to Break pasta in half?

The reason why you should not break pasta is thatit's supposed to wrap around your fork. That's how longpasta is supposed to be eaten. You rotate your fork, and itshould be long enough to both stick to itself and get entangled ina way that it doesn't slip off or lets sauce drip fromit.

Do you need to drain pasta?

Pasta should never, ever be rinsed for a warmdish. The starch in the water is what helps the sauce adhere toyour pasta. The only time you should ever rinse yourpasta is when you are going to use it in a cold dishlike a pasta salad or when you are not going to useit immediately.
